Q2 2025 was the healthiest spring market Tampa Bay has seen in four years. Rates dipped below 6.5%, inventory sat at a balanced 3.5-4 months of supply, and median prices appreciated 2-3% year-over-year. Neither buyers nor sellers dominated — deals were getting done with fair negotiations on both sides.
What Were Median Home Prices in Q2 2025?
Hillsborough County: $412,000, up 3.5% from Q2 2024. Valrico, Riverview, and Brandon continued strong volume. Pinellas County: $405,000, up 5.2%. Limited land supply pushed prices higher. Pasco County: $375,000, up 5.6%. Wesley Chapel new construction led gains. Manatee County: $448,000, up 3.7%. Bradenton and Parrish remained active. Sarasota County: $478,000, up 3.9%. Polk County: $335,000, up 5.3%. Fastest-growing county by percentage for the third straight quarter.
How Did Rates Affect Activity?
Rates dropping below 6.5% brought a wave of buyers who had been waiting since 2023. Pre-approval volume was up 30% year-over-year. The psychological "below 6.5%" threshold was significant — buyers who could not stomach 7% rates found 6.25-6.5% acceptable. First-time buyers using FHA and VA loans represented 35% of purchases, the highest share since 2020.
What Was the Builder Market Doing?
Builder incentives moderated slightly as demand improved — why discount when buyers are showing up? Rate buydowns remained common but the dollar amounts decreased. Instead of $30K in incentives, builders offered $15K-$20K. Quick-move-in specs still offered the best deals. For buyers, the incentive window was narrowing — the time to negotiate hard was Q4 2024 through Q1 2025.
What Is the Summer Outlook?
Tampa Bay's market typically slows 10-15% in summer (June-August) as families settle into school schedules and seasonal buyers head north. Expect steady activity but fewer bidding situations than spring. Sellers listing in summer face less competition from other sellers — fewer listings means more visibility for each home. For buyers, summer offers slightly less competition than the spring rush.
